The vast majority of the hyacinth macaw eating plan is made up of nuts from unique palm species, which include acuri and bocaiuva palms.[17] They may have pretty potent beaks for feeding on the kernels of challenging nuts and seeds. Their sturdy beaks are even capable of crack coconuts, the large Brazil nut pods, and macadamia nuts. The birds also boast dry, smooth tongues that has a bone inside of them which makes them a successful Software for tapping into fruits.

The glaucous macaw (Anodorhynchus glaucus) is actually a critically endangered or quite possibly extinct species of enormous, blue and gray South American parrot, a member of a giant team of neotropical parrots known as macaws.

English doctor, ornithologist, and artist John Latham first explained the hyacinth macaw in 1790 under the binomial identify Psittacus hyacinthinus.[3] Tony Pittman in 2000 hypothesized that Even though the illustration On this function seems for being of the genuine hyacinthine macaw, Latham's description in the duration in the bird might indicate he had measured a specimen of Lear's macaw instead.
